AHLA workforce report: Hotels add 1,200 jobs in April
U.S. hotels added 1,200 jobs to their payrolls in April, according to the latest government data that shows employment in the industry is still far from pre-pandemic levels. Total hotel employment stands at about 1.92 million, according to the Bureau of Labor Statistics.
